ANATOMY 2 - Topics for closing dissection oral examination

Closing dissection oral examination – Friday – dissection week 

Practical examination  - theoretical knowledge with the demostration on the cadaver, cadaveric samples and models  

Student will pick up /take 1 question from the list below.  He/she will use the cadaveric specimen or model and will describe the organ (with showing the structures at the organ), its relations, external description, projection to the skeleton, blood supply and also innervation of the organs in the range of the cranial nerves etc.

As for the vessels and nerves student will explain the course, relations, branches and what is supllied by the vessel or the nerve.  Student will have 3 minutes to think (but no writing on the paper sheet) and then he/she will speak. The oral exam will take 7-10 minutes.
